Do You Have A Mustard Seed?

November 5, 2017 • Anne Trufant

Even though it’s one of the smallest seeds, the trees can grow up to 20 feet tall and 20 feet wide. The tree can grow in arid, dry climates and thrive in all kinds of soil. So we can see the mustard seed as a symbol of our faith that can be tested in “dry times” and the most difficult of circumstances. Even if the tree is cut down to the trunk, it can grow back again. In this Focus show, Anne teaches us that mustard seed faith is that even during times of “pruning” we can overcome and come back stronger than ever just like the mustard tree that’s been severly pruned if only a little bit of faith remains. Over and over Anne reminds us that even when we are planted in poor soil we can still grow even if we have a smalll amount of faith. So get the faith of a mustard seed and don’t be afraid to use it!

A Minute in the Church

Gus Lloyd

Do Catholics read the Bible? Why do Catholics honor Mary? What is with all of these statues? Usually people object to the Catholic Faith based on Scriptual grounds. They claim the teachings of the Catholic Church are contrary to the clear teachings of the Bible, and these misrepresentations have led countless souls out of the Church. However, Scripture read in context fully supports Catholic teachings. Apologetics is all about knowing why we do what we do and believe what we believe. It is building the case for our Faith, learning how to explain and defend our Faith. "Always be ready to give an explanation to anyone who ask for a reason for your hope."-1Peter 3:15. Can we defend our church in a minute?

He Who Sings Prays Twice

December 29, 2019 • Donna Lee music

Donna Lee first started singing at the age of seven. In 1972, she joined the folk group at her local parish where she played guitar and sang for 11 years. Her debut album Immaculate Heart, O Sacred Heart was released in 1990. Since then, she has continued to release music, and became one of the founding members of the Catholic Association of Music. Donna Lee continues to travel around the world playing her music. We hope you will enjoy this special Focus program featuring the music of three-time Unity Award-winner Donna Lee.
